Card

Common expressions

  • exchange business card

  • pay by credit card

  • carry a donor card

  • pay by debit card

  • use a phone card

  • show your identity card

Common expressions

  1. I prefer to pay by credit card than by debit card. With credit cards you don't have to pay till the end of the month, but with debit cards, the money comes out of your account straightaway.

  2. Do you know that it's much cheaper to make international calls if you use a phone card?

  3. We exchanged business cards at the beginning of the meeting.

  4. We have to show our identity cards to the guard at the gate when we arrive in the morning.

  5. I've always carried a donor card. I like to think that if I die in an accident, my heart and other organs will be userul to someone else.

Note

We send cards to each other on special occasions:

  • I must remember to send Carol a birthday card. She's 30 next month.

  • Thank you for the card. It was really nice of you to remember!
